What is the equation for a line with slope of 0.75 and y intercept of -5?

y= 0.75x - 5 y=0.75x5

Explanation:

Here given that slope (m) = 0.75(m)=0.75
and yy-intercept of -55 means that the line passes through the yy-axis at y=-5y=5.

The xx-coordinate at yy-axis is zero

So (x1,y1) = (0,-5)(x1,y1)=(0,5) is the point the line passes through

Equation of the line is given by;

(y-y1)=m(x-x1)(yy1)=m(xx1)

(y+5) =0.75(x-0)(y+5)=0.75(x0)

y+5 = 0.75xy+5=0.75x

So,
y= 0.75x - 5y=0.75x5 is the equation of the line.
